Unlocking The Secrets of Successful Nursing

This breastfeeding class by certified lactation support counselor Danielle Bianco covers topics such as normal infant feeding behavior, lactation basics, establishing a good latch and milk supply, common challenges, and nutritional considerations. Expectant parents will learn about the benefits of breastfeeding, how to incorporate it into their daily routine, and how to advocate for themselves in the hospital. The class aims to prepare parents for their breastfeeding journey, and it includes a Q&A session with the instructor.​
  • Advocating for yourself in the hospital
  • Lactation basics & positions
  • Common tackles
  • Pumping basics
  • Starting out right straight from the hospital
  • Nutritional considerations
  • Q & A with postpartum doula, certified lactation support counselor & pediatric sleep counselor Danielle Bianco, owner of Beloved Birth & Baby.

Also includes bonus lactation guide with all the information to take home on positioning, lactation basics & more.

Building a Toolbox for Comfort: Essential Skills for Labor

This childbirth education class by Danielle Bianco goes beyond the basics and focuses on techniques for a faster, smoother, and more comfortable labor. It covers breathing exercises, relaxation techniques, visualization, movement, nutrition, and exercise during pregnancy. The class also deals with emotional and mental preparation for childbirth, including common fears and concerns surrounding labor and delivery. Topics such as massage techniques, counter pressure and hip squeezes, position changes, and hospital space usage are also discussed. Participants will leave the class feeling confident and empowered, ready for a positive birth experience regardless of the delivery location.
​Topic include:
  • Massage techniques for labor
  • Counter pressure and hip squeezes
  • Position changes
  • How to use the hospital space
  • Laboring at home
  • What is a peanut ball and how to use it
